Joan Nguyen is a venture-backed founder, AI builder, and advisor helping founders, executives, and teams turn AI into practical leverage.
You don't have to be technical to build with AI—but you do have to learn how to think differently about what technology can now do.
She is the founder of Bumo AI, an AI company at the intersection of family and childcare, and has personally vibe coded more than 7 million lines of code. With a background in education and company-building rather than traditional engineering, Joan has developed a unique ability to bridge the gap between rapidly evolving AI technology and the people and organizations trying to put it to work.
Joan is a co-founder of the Kinship AI Fellowship alongside Gwyneth Paltrow, Moj Mahdara, and Sarah Willersdorf, and co-founded AI Maxxing, a six-week intensive program helping founders, builders, and creators become dramatically more capable with AI. She has spoken about AI at the Metamorphosis Conference and presented at the AI Demo Summit hosted by True Ventures.
Today, Joan's work focuses on AI transformation: helping leaders identify where AI can create the most leverage, redesign workflows around AI, and give their teams the tools and confidence to actually adopt it. Her particular strength is working with non-technical leaders and teams—translating what's possible with AI into practical systems that save time, increase output, and change how organizations operate.
